Essay |
a piece of writing that gives your thoughts about a subject, all essays will have 4 paragraphs |
|
Introduction ( aka introductory paragraph ) |
the 1st paragraph in an essay it includes the thesis, most often at the end |
|
Body paragraph |
a middle paragraph in an essay it develops a point you want to make that supports your thesis |
|
Conclusion ( aka concluding paragraph ) |
last paragraph in an essay sums up your ideas |
|
Thesis |
an arguable claim |
|
Pre-writing |
process of getting your evidence down on paper before you organize your essay into paragraphs |
|
Evidence |
specific details that form the backbone of your paragraphs |
|
Analysis |
your informed opinion or comment about something |
|
Topic sentence |
the first sentence in a body paragraph |
|
Concluding sentece |
the last sentence in a body paragraph |
|
Drafting |
the writing and revising of your essay |
|
Final draft |
the final version of your essay |
|
Peer response |
written responses and reactions to a partner's paper |
